Responsibilities:
  • The Dialysis Technician will provide direct patient care under the direction of a Registered Nurse to all assigned patients and maintain a safe patient area.
  • Assisting in the maintenance of a safe and clean work environment
  • Provide safe, effective delivery of patient care in compliance with standards outlined in the facility procedure manual, as well as regulations set forth by the corporation, state, and federal agencies
  • Provided the direct patient care for ESRD assigned patients under the direct supervision of a licensed nurse
  • Responsible for accurate documentation of information related to the patient treatment.
  • Information is documented by the technician in the appropriate patient record.
  • Monitor and document dialysis treatment parameters on Dialysis Flow Sheets
  • Report any significant information or change in patient condition to the R.N.
  • Assist with all emergency operational procedures
  • Initiate basic CPR measures in the event of cardiac and/or pulmonary arrest and respond to emergency situations related to dialysis treatment.
  • Able to safely operate all dialysis-related equipment safely
  • Able to provide minor troubleshooting when necessary
  • Familiarity with all emergency equipment.
  • Recognize and respond to machine alarms.
  • Participate in staff meetings as scheduled.
  • Assist in patient care plan meetings when appropriate.
  • Acquire information and knowledge in current practice related to dialysis techniques and principles by participating in scheduled in-service classes
  • Perform additional duties as assigned by the supervisor
Qualifications:

Job Requirements:

  • High school degree or GED
  • Successfully complete a training course in the theory and practice of hemodialysis
  • Certification from an accredited dialysis program
  • BLS certification must be obtained within 14 days of hire or transfer into the role and prior to providing direct patient care.

Preferred Job Requirements:

  • Previous experience in a Dialysis facility
